Merge tag 'perf-core-for-mingo-20160901'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/acme/linux into perf/core
Pull perf/core improvements and fixes from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o: User visible changes: - Support generating cross arch probes, i.e. if you specify a vmlinux file for different arch than the one in the host machine, $ perf probe --definition function_name args will generate the probe definition string needed to append to the target machine /sys/kernel/debug/tracing/kprobes_events file, using scripting (Masami Hiramatsu). - Make 'perf probe' skip the function prologue in uprobes if program compiled without optimization, using the same strategy as gdb and systemtap uses, fixing a bug where: $ perf probe -x ./test 'foo i' When 'foo(42)' was used on the "./test" executable would produce i=0 instead of the expected i=42 (Ravi Bangoria) - Demangle symbols for synthesized @plt entries too (Millian Wolff) Documentation changes: - Show default report configuration in 'perf config' example and docs (Millian Wolff) Infrastructure changes: - Make 'perf test vmlinux' tolerate the symbol aliasing pruning done when loading kallsyms and vmlinux (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o) - Improve output of 'perf test vmlinux' test, to help identify on the verbose output which lines are warning and which are errors (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o) - Prep work to stop having to pass symbol_filter_t to lots of functions, simplifying symtab loading routines (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o) - Honor symbol_conf.allow_aliases when loading kallsyms as well, it was using it only when loading vmlinux files (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o) - Fixup symbol->end before doing alias pruning when loading symbol tables (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o) - Fix error handling of lzma kernel module decompression (Shawn Lin) Signed-off-by: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@redhat.com> Signed-off-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@kernel.org>
